Dan Finlay
|
21bde66e16
|
Remove account-tracker from keyringController
|
2017-10-18 17:14:26 -07:00 |
|
Dan Finlay
|
bbe2c9f48d
|
Merge remote-tracking branch 'origin/master' into i2348-SelectAccountOnNewVault
|
2017-10-18 17:07:25 -07:00 |
|
Dan Finlay
|
d89394a7c9
|
Make account tracking much more reactive
|
2017-10-18 17:07:22 -07:00 |
|
kumavis
|
8da0d0b28a
|
Revert "NetworkController refactor for new EthClient interface"
|
2017-10-18 15:09:32 -07:00 |
|
Dan Finlay
|
75177ce34c
|
Make account tracking more reactive
We were doing a lot of conditional observation & updating.
Pulled out a bunch of that for generic observer/syncers.
|
2017-10-18 15:08:34 -07:00 |
|
Dan Finlay
|
9cc1e8a6d8
|
Refresh computed balances controller when restoring vault
|
2017-10-18 14:22:04 -07:00 |
|
Dan Finlay
|
ea79eca8eb
|
Add validation to balance constructor
|
2017-10-18 12:21:22 -07:00 |
|
Dan Finlay
|
7032edf32b
|
Stop tracking old account balances after restore vault
Per @kgserrano note
|
2017-10-18 11:13:14 -07:00 |
|
Dan Finlay
|
50e8599988
|
Promisify metamask-controller vault creating methods
|
2017-10-17 13:25:27 -07:00 |
|
Dan Finlay
|
d7f384485d
|
Select first account when restoring seed
Fixes #2348
|
2017-10-17 13:19:57 -07:00 |
|
Dan Finlay
|
ab31eb6a17
|
Select first account on new vault creation
|
2017-10-17 13:09:41 -07:00 |
|
kumavis
|
53a360b65d
|
contentscript - fix inpage require and bundling
|
2017-10-12 12:51:48 -07:00 |
|
Dan Finlay
|
c9a984a237
|
Break up inpage file read into multiple lines
|
2017-10-12 14:16:40 -04:00 |
|
Dan Finlay
|
d0d082d70c
|
Merge branch 'master' into i1340-SynchronousInjection
|
2017-10-12 13:25:19 -04:00 |
|
kumavis
|
dcf10f3d75
|
nonce-tracker - use blockTracker directly
|
2017-10-11 18:33:36 -07:00 |
|
kumavis
|
0f8d7dacb1
|
network-controller - use obj-proxy for providerProxy
|
2017-10-10 17:26:44 -07:00 |
|
kumavis
|
7d50a56198
|
util - add obj-proxy
|
2017-10-10 17:15:52 -07:00 |
|
kumavis
|
e32d75965f
|
events-proxy - clean up
|
2017-10-10 17:15:14 -07:00 |
|
kumavis
|
4d273d3cea
|
lint fixes
|
2017-10-10 14:14:43 -07:00 |
|
kumavis
|
efa92a7fc5
|
network controller - refactor to use eth-rpc-client
|
2017-10-10 14:13:12 -07:00 |
|
kumavis
|
ff4e9a0d11
|
metamask controller - define this.newTransaction to ease instantiation order
|
2017-10-10 10:50:45 -07:00 |
|
kumavis
|
f7c1bc804d
|
metamask controller - simplify provider init
|
2017-10-10 10:39:31 -07:00 |
|
kumavis
|
e79037261e
|
metamask controller - breakout getAccounts method
|
2017-10-10 10:26:59 -07:00 |
|
Dan Finlay
|
7f70c866c3
|
Merge pull request #2223 from ukstv/master
Add eth_signTypedData handler
|
2017-10-09 12:18:43 -07:00 |
|
Sergey Ukustov
|
a1696f89a8
|
Validate data format for eth_signTypedData
|
2017-10-07 00:38:13 +03:00 |
|
Frankie
|
4a4338c1f4
|
Merge pull request #2305 from MetaMask/nodeify
nodeify - allow callback to be optional
|
2017-10-06 14:08:58 -07:00 |
|
Dan Finlay
|
0c61695656
|
Merge branch 'master' into SignTypedData
|
2017-10-06 14:03:04 -07:00 |
|
kumavis
|
fa11bbf996
|
Merge pull request #2304 from MetaMask/i1531-UpdateTxStatesOnInit
Update status of pending transactions on startup
|
2017-10-06 13:40:43 -07:00 |
|
kumavis
|
bc396a7417
|
lint fix - nodeify
|
2017-10-06 13:02:34 -07:00 |
|
Dan Finlay
|
a417fab0eb
|
When checking pending txs, check for successful txs with same nonce.
If a successful tx with the same nonce exists, transition tx to the failed state.
Fixes #2294
|
2017-10-06 12:51:13 -07:00 |
|
Dan Finlay
|
94513cae7b
|
Provide method for tx tracker to refer to all txs
|
2017-10-06 12:50:33 -07:00 |
|
kumavis
|
be4f7b33f4
|
nodeify - allow callback to be optional
|
2017-10-06 12:36:08 -07:00 |
|
Dan Finlay
|
0146b55d6d
|
Check status of pending transactions on startup
Fixes #1531
|
2017-10-06 11:41:28 -07:00 |
|
Dan Finlay
|
cf178341c1
|
Merge branch 'master' into SignTypedData
|
2017-10-05 14:50:19 -07:00 |
|
Dan Finlay
|
9bc80d998e
|
Add signTypedData input validations
|
2017-10-05 14:39:35 -07:00 |
|
Dan Finlay
|
c5b7880f05
|
Merge branch 'master' into SignTypedData
|
2017-10-05 11:55:23 -07:00 |
|
frankiebee
|
3cb9da2ae5
|
"fix" hours for message
|
2017-10-05 11:42:01 -07:00 |
|
frankiebee
|
ec9c528313
|
pending-tx - check time stamp instead of block number for resubmit
|
2017-10-05 11:07:22 -07:00 |
|
Dan Finlay
|
1cba6543a4
|
Begin implementing sync injection idea
|
2017-10-04 15:35:04 -07:00 |
|
Frankie
|
948a0b1078
|
Merge pull request #2250 from interfect/master
Don't pass origin as an HTTP header
|
2017-10-03 10:36:39 -07:00 |
|
Sergey Ukustov
|
e11ca12890
|
Merge remote-tracking branch 'upstream/master'
|
2017-10-03 02:10:47 +03:00 |
|
kumavis
|
062eaa6a82
|
pending tx tracker - on tx:warn append error message instead of error obj
|
2017-10-02 15:39:11 -07:00 |
|
kumavis
|
ed77304e73
|
pending tx tracker - tx:warning event includes err obj
|
2017-10-02 15:20:01 -07:00 |
|
kumavis
|
22eaf92ec2
|
pending tx tracker - resubmit - warn dont error on unknown error
|
2017-10-02 15:00:23 -07:00 |
|
kumavis
|
7af696bfbe
|
pending tx tracker - dont throw on load failure
|
2017-10-02 14:56:59 -07:00 |
|
kumavis
|
167ad729fd
|
Merge branch 'history-notes' of github.com:MetaMask/metamask-extension into history-notes
|
2017-10-02 13:45:47 -07:00 |
|
frankiebee
|
e08a727d44
|
Merge branch 'master' into history-notes
|
2017-10-02 13:44:15 -07:00 |
|
kumavis
|
df59ef9942
|
tx state history - append note to first op of diff
|
2017-10-02 13:44:11 -07:00 |
|
frankiebee
|
833da191c3
|
transaction - provide notes for history
|
2017-10-02 13:41:29 -07:00 |
|
kumavis
|
d29b5f10ef
|
tx state history - fix bug where initial snapshot was mutated on updateTx
|
2017-10-02 13:14:42 -07:00 |
|